                  @Verdad I would assume it's due to the pituitary action (primarily prolactin, but also endorphins and oxytocin) that happens during and right-after orgasm. Although I'm not sure why you'd want to avoid this, in healthy people the response is very brief. Low thyroid or low testosterone men might have more difficulty bouncing back.

                  The evolutionary purpose of sex is suppose to be quick. Because if you're fucking all day then you're not gathering food, water, or defending against possible predators...this is actually counter intuitive to survival and reproduction.

                  Now I'm not suggesting every dude needs to be a premature ejaculator, lol. But if you have to try really really hard to cum then that might be suggestive of some sort of sexual dysfunction. The only "cheat" a healthy male can do to bypass this is to edge themselves during sex.
